The Game: Released in 2007 by ESP Software, Hajime no Ippo Portable: Victorious Spirits is a sports boxing game featuring over 40 playable characters.
Unlike arcade-style boxing games such as Punch-Out!! or Ready 2 Rumble, the Hajime no Ippo games are celebrated for their simulation-heavy approach. They utilize a "First-Person View" mode that mimics the perspective of a boxer inside the ring, limiting visibility and emphasizing the need for intuition, blocking, and counter-punching. The gameplay requires players to manage stamina, learn opponent patterns, and execute specific special moves like the "Dempsey Roll."
